How to propagate coleus by cuttings

Time for cutting of coleus

There are two methods of propagating coleus: sowing and cuttings, among which cuttings are the simplest. It can be carried out throughout the year. Except for the winter when the temperature is low and the rooting is sufficient, the spring and summer when the temperature is suitable are the best seasons for cuttings.

Coleus branches

Coleus is a perennial herb, but it is mostly cultivated as an annual in households. Very suitable for propagation by cuttings of terminal buds.

Select plants with terminal buds and 3 to 5 nodes. Stem nodes with a length of 5 to 10 cm are used as cuttings. After cutting the cuttings, trim the local leaves to avoid excessive leaves and branches losing water, which may lead to failure of cuttings. Usually all the leaves on the lower part of the branches should be cut off, and it is enough to keep a few leaves on the upper part!

How to propagate coleus

Coleus grows quickly. You can easily plant the strong branches individually in a pot with a diameter of 7.5 cm. After the cuttings are successful, you can directly maintain them in the pot. If there is a large space at home and the environment is suitable, you can plant the cuttings in a larger flower trough.

Rooting time of coleus

Coleus takes root very quickly, and roots will grow about a week after cuttings. Apply dilute liquid fertilizer or slow-release fertilizer 2 weeks after cuttings to allow the coleus to enter the initial growth stage. After the coleus grows normally, it is necessary to pinch the top once to promote branching and improve the ornamental value of the small potted plants.

The seedlings from cuttings gradually grew bigger. It can be grown in pots or in a large pot in a potting mix. In addition, coleus grows rapidly in summer and requires proper pruning to ensure its beauty.
